Rainbow Six Siege Getting Skin Trading in New Marketplace; Operation Deep Freeze Fully Detailed

The upcoming season for Tom Clancy's Rainbow Six Siege, Operation Deep Freeze, has been fully revealed, and it'll include a marketplace that will allow players to buy and sell skins among themselves.

Today Ubisoft fully revealed the new season coming to its popular multiplayer tactical shooter Tom Clancy's Rainbow Six Siege, titled "Operation Deep Freeze." 

Operation Deep Freeze will release on the live servers on November 28 and the test server will launch tomorrow, November 13.

Of course, the lion's share of the new season is taken by the new operator,Tubarão, hailing from Portugal. He is equipped with a freezing canister containing liquid nitrogen and liquid oxygen, capable of freezing anything (or anyone) it hits. Enemies will be slowed down and leave frozen footsteps.

Interestingly, the footsteps are also visible on the ceiling below you, which means that enemies would be able to shoot you through the floor. Gadgets will also be disabled or paused.

The developers also introduced the new map "The Lair" portraying a Deimos base. 

Interestingly, the game will also get AI bots. For now, players will be able to play attackers against defender operators in bomb defusal mode. Still, in future seasons the AI will get more operators to pick from and will be available to play on the attack instead of just defense.  

Full controller remapping is coming alongside improvements for the leaning behavior, albeit this will arrive later in the season. New player onboarding is also getting some relevant changes including a feature that lets players explore maps.

That being said, Situations and Training Grounds will be removed. On the other hand, more updates will come to the shooting range to help out both new players and veterans.

We learn that the shield rework has been pushed back to year 9 season 1, but a test server will go live during the span of Operation Deep Freeze to let players test the changes.

Another feature that will officially come in year 9 season 1 is the Marketplace, which will let players sell unwanted skins and buy them (for Rainbow Six credits). That being said, a beta version will be released in Operation Deep Freeze and you can register at the official site.

Last, but not least (or perhaps least if you're not interested in collaborations), two new skins are available now in collaboration with Street Fighter 6, Grim as Ryu and Ying as Chun Li.
